   In 1989, at the direction of Congress, the URA's implementing regulations were issued by FHWA as 49 CFR part __. 

What is part 24?

200

This residential payment cap was raised from $7,200 to $9,570.

What is the Replacement Housing Payment for 90-Day tenants at Section 24.402(b)

200

The definition of "adequate in size" now states: "The number of persons occupying each habitable room used for ______   _______ shall not exceed that permitted by the most stringent of the local housing code, Federal agency regulations or requirements, or the agency's regulations or written policy.  

What is "sleeping purposes", i.e., bedrooms.

The Uniform Act law was most recently amended in 2012 by this Act which increased certain statutory relocation payment maximums.  

What is MAP-21? 

300

This residential payment cap was raised from $31,000 to $41,000.

What is Replacement housing payment for 90-day homewoner occupants under Section 24.401?

400

This non-residential move payment cap was raised from $25,000 to $33,200.

What is the  Reestablishment payment under Section 24.304?

400

The final rule added two new categories -  "persons required to move temporarily" and "voluntary acquisitions" - to the definition of this term.

What is "Displaced person"?

500

Costs for cosmetic alterations or improvements to replacement dwellings, and costs for constructing, reconstructing or rehabilitating a building as a new business location are additions to these existing payment categories under 24.301(h) and 24.304(b).

What are ineligible moving and reestablishment costs?

500

This non-residential "move" payment cap was raised from $40,000 to $53,200.

What is the Fixed payment in lieu (of all other moving payments) at Section 24.305?

500

The final rule deleted this element from every term listed under definitions. (Hint: this deletion will make citing these definitions more difficult in the future.)

What is the numbering element?  The final rule has removed the number preceding each term that was present under definitions in the January 4 2005 version of the CFR.
